<br />U Nonprofit organizations to whom [ ] any grant is awarded shall
<br />agree to comply with the following conditions before receiving the grant:
<br />(1) Employ and appoint persons on the basis of merit and ability;
<br />(2) Comply with applicable Federal and State laws prohibiting discrimination
<br />against any person on the basis of race, color, national origin, religion, creed,
<br />sex, age, or [handieW;] disabili
<br />(3) Agree not to use any public funds for purposes of persona l entertainment or
<br />perquisites;
<br />(4) Comply with such other requirements as the director may prescribe to ensure
<br />adherence by the nonprofit organization with Federal, State, and County laws,
<br />and established standards for fiscal and program management;
<br />(5) Allow the director, the committees of the council and their staffs, and the
<br />[legislature] Com1y auditor access to facilities, personnel, records, reports,
<br />files, and other related documents in order that the program, management, and
<br />fiscal practices of the nonprofit organization may be monitored and evaluated
<br />to assure the proper and effective expenditure of public funds; and
